# Break-Glass: Catalog Cache Invalidation

Scope: the Pinrow product catalog at Veldstone Retail. If stale prices persist after a purge and the Hollowmere invalidation queue is wedged, use break-glass to flush the edge tier directly. Contractors: get verbal sign-off from the catalog lead first. Steps: open the Hollowmere admin shell, select emergency-flush, confirm the tenant, and run it once — repeated flushes thrash the origin. Access is logged and expires after 20 minutes. Unseal the admin shell with the passphrase below.

recovery phrase for kahop-tajog: istix-casvan

Handover note — Crumbwheel order cutoffs.

Welcome aboard. The bakery cutoff rule in Crumbwheel closes same-day orders at 14:00 local to each storefront, not UTC — this has bitten us twice. Holiday overrides live in the calendar service and take precedence silently, so always check there first when a cutoff looks wrong. To unlock the calendar service's admin console after a restart, enter the recovery passphrase below.

vault phrase of bagap-bahaf = silion-pelox-sorox-casdor-quenwyn-fraax-eliox-praael-kelion-quenvan-kasox-rusael-norius-belvan

Profiles in the Quillhaven store are sharded by a stable hash of the account ID across 32 logical shards mapped to 8 physical nodes. Resharding is online: the router consults the shard map service, never a static config, so do not hardcode shard assignments. Writes fence on a shard epoch; a stale epoch returns 409 and the client must refetch the map. All shard-map reads from the router require authentication against the internal map service, using the key that follows.

API key for kahop-bagef: zpat2_yb

## Provenance: Ticket-Pricing Experiment

Welcome aboard! Quick orientation: the dynamic ticket-pricing experiment on Farelight ships from its own pipeline, separate from the main storefront. Every experiment build is signed at the end of CI, and the attestation records which pricing model snapshot was baked in. If someone asks "which prices were live at 3pm Tuesday," you answer with the build record, not a guess. Don't hand-edit configs — it breaks the chain. The provenance token for the current experiment build is listed just below.

pipeline stamp: htk31_f769b577b3028a4e9958e5bb8d1259a